Address 0 PIV

D6sYSXv1wZScfTBXRn6gfYhEpsJfxLzege

Confirmed

Total Received21.3712557 PIV
Total Sent21.3712557 PIV
Final Balance0 PIV
No. Transactions2

Transactions

Fee: 0.0001 PIV
2759117 Confirmations128.36607521 PIV
DEWDDZiSH72St7eHTqJ2L92VFtyEKyNs4M19.2956941 PIV
D6sYSXv1wZScfTBXRn6gfYhEpsJfxLzege21.3712557 PIV
Fee: 0.0001 PIV
2759175 Confirmations40.6669498 PIV